Closing - Documentation only, no code change

This PR only adds a comment explaining why an existing :has() selector is acceptable. No actual code or behavior changes.

+  /*
+   * NOTE: Uses descendant :has() - input is not direct child of TextInputWrapper
+   * due to TextInputInnerVisualSlot wrappers. This is acceptable performance
+   * as the search is scoped to this single element's subtree.
+   */

While the documentation is helpful, it doesn't warrant a patch release since there's no behavior change.

Added documentation explaining why the :has(input:placeholder-shown) selector is acceptable.
